NBA Collective Bargaining Agreement
The NBA Collective Bargaining Agreement (CBA) is the contract between the NBA (the commissioner and the 30 team owners) and the NBA Players Association that dictates the rules of player contracts, trades, revenue distribution, the NBA Draft, and the salary cap, among other things.
